Nice plants!

I would imagine they would enjoy being outside during the summer if you have a good spot for them.

They should all be relatively easy in normal humidity, although they would enjoy more. I think you will find that they will get a bit big and awkward for a light stand after a while. I have my lobbianus hanging over the edge of one so it's possible.... The only tricky time I had with that one is when I had long growths and few roots - it needed higher humidity for a while then.

I haven't grown the other two, but I have similar things. Being epiphytes they will prefer good drainage - more than AVs.I think my mix for them is about the same as for the streps. Although they like drainage, they also like to be watered regularly (I am learning my lesson). You should still be able to wick water if the mix is light. I wonder if your columnea will grow like schiediana which is one tough cookie that will take a ton of abuse.
